: Data Integration Architect - GRM US
15 Rye St
Portsmouth, NH 03801


As the Data Integration Architect, you will be responsible for defining the data integration architecture for application and data teams, including: orchestration of data and services across applications; ensuring availability, performance, security and quality objectives; defining standards for enterprise application integrations as well as reference and master data management. You will provide governance and life-cycle frameworks / tools for API and Event producers to publish and enable the developer community to consume APIs and Events in a secure & easy manner/

The Data Integration Architect will be the lead technical member responsible for designing, leading and mentoring the implementation of application integration with large scale data repositories (DBMS, NoSQL etc.) as well as for transactional and operational data used to create, read, update, delete, move and synchronize enterprise application data. You will be a partner with Application Architects and Application Product Owners, and provide technical data direction to Data Custodians, Application Developers, Business Analysts and Data Stewards.

The Data Integration Architect is expected to understand business goals and develop a strategy focused on these goals that: capitalizes on technology insights to improve the value of operations through analytical data; improves the effectiveness of information stewardship; and will drive the strategy for data integration in the organization.

What you will do:
  • Design and implement modern data integration technologies and solutions to support microservices-based application architectures
  • Provide direction, assistance and education to teams on the appropriate use of databases (relational, NoSQL, graph, etc)
  • Provide direction, assistance and education to teams on the appropriate use of integration technologies (APIs, message-oriented middleware, streaming, event processing systems, etc.)
  • Define data integration flows (ETL, ELT, stream processing, events/event processors, etc.)
  • Coordinate the proper definition of data working with Data Stewards and implementing through Data Custodians and the application teams
  • Define database and integration tool selection criteria, standards and best practices for application architectures
  • Architect and lead system availability, usability, performance and security database methodologies
  • Partner with other Application, Data and Infrastructure Architects to deliver best in class solutions
  • Assist with future release planning and data integration needs analysis
  • Be a team player with ability to drive for win-win solutions across multiple competing interests, teams and priorities
What you will need:
  • Bachelor's or Master's degree in technical discipline; Master's preferred.
  • 10+ years of architecture experience in applications development in a complex, multi-platform distributed environment.
  • Thorough knowledge of RDMS Systems (MySQL, MS SQL Server, Postgres, Oracle)
  • Data Modeling Expertise (Conceptual, Logical & Physical in both Relational & Dimensional)
  • Experience using OLTP / OLAP / Graph / Multi-Model / NoSQL databases
  • Practical experience using message-oriented middleware (IBM MQ, AWS SNS or similar)
  • Ability to deploy and manage APIs (Apigee, AWS API Gateway, Anypoint or similar)
  • Ability to create/consume Swagger (OpenAPI) and WSDL service definitions
  • To identify the appropriate use of of semi-structured and telemetry data formats (including JSON, XML, Parquet, MQTT, AMQP)
  • Ability to design and build orchestration/choreography for Service Oriented, Service Based and MicroServices architectures (Mulesoft or similar)
  • Ability to build, configure and deploy ETL (Informatica, Snaplogic, Dell Boomi)
  • Ability to build, configure and deploy Message event handlers (AWS EventBridge or similar)
  • Ability to use and configure Stream Processing systems (Kafka/Kafka Connect, Spark, Flink, AWS Kinesis)

We value your hard work, integrity and dedication to positive change. In return for your service, its our privilege to offer you benefits and rewards that support your life and well-being. To learn more about our benefit offerings please visit: https://LMI.co/Benefits

Liberty Mutual is an equal opportunity employer. We embrace an environment that is free from all discrimination in the workplace, in its business, or by its vendors. Liberty Mutual values diversity and the differences and similarities of our employees. We foster a diverse and inclusive work environment that leads to better ideas, stronger teams and more innovative products and services for our customers. Learn more


Employee Testimonials

Steve H.

"The biggest misconception about Tech at Liberty Mutual is that the technology shop here is outdated, boring and lacks opportunity. There is a strong push for failing fast, going agile, building microservices, using the latest technology tools and building a culture of innovation."

Matt W.

"I like working at Liberty Mutual because they treat their employees very well. Liberty understands the importance of a work-life balance. Because I have significant vacation time, and a flexible workplace schedule, I come to work happier every day. I don't feel the pressure that I may be fired if I need to take a few days off or can't make it into the office due an appointment."

Matt K.

"I immensely enjoy what I get to work on every day. Reading about machine learning and applying it in a way that has actual business value is great."

Cara B.

"We are working with top notch technologies and we get to live a little. We have the best of both worlds here."

Jeremiah T.

"The sense of community working here has been a lot different than I expected at a big company. Everyone is helpful and looking to make sure you have the resources you needed to grow in the company."